KUB Coin is the native utility token of KUB Chain, a Thai blockchain ecosystem developed by Bitkub Blockchain Technology. It powers enterprise and consumer-decentralized applications using a Proof-of-Authority consensus mechanism with high throughput. KUB supports ecosystem utility and staking-based governance through gKUB.

It empowers users to securely monetize their private data through Data DAOs (Decentralized Autonomous Organizations) and innovative mechanisms like Proof-of-Contribution. By aggregating and validating data through Data Liquidity Pools (DLPs), Vana supports AI model training while protecting privacy and user ownership. With its focus on creating a new asset class of data tokens, Vana bridges Web2 and Web3, paving the way for a revolutionary AI-driven data economy.
